New Delhi: Ravichandran Ashwin grabbed the whole headlines in the first Test against Bangladesh in Chennai with a formidable hundred and a 5-wicket haul en path to India’s emphatic 280-run win last week. With the 2d Test starting in a pair of day’s time, the veteran all-rounder is in a position to break every other set of records in Kanpur when the game commences on September 24.

Thought about one of many foremost dependable players for India in the last decade, Ashwin has ticked the whole boxes – be it for a bowler and a batter. His century in Chennai is a testament to his intent and self assurance on the heart when the head order failed to put up a show.

List of records Ravichandran Ashwin can break in Kanpur

  • Ravichandran Ashwin equaled legendary Shane Warne for the Thirty seventh 5-wicket haul when his 6/88 rattled Bangladesh in the 2d innings of the first Test. The off-spinner can surpass Warne if he gets every other in Kanpur. Most effective Muttiah Muralitharan is beforehand of the 2 with sixty seven fifers in Tests.
  • Ravichandran Ashwin has over and over again proved why he is one amongst of the foremost-sought bowlers against the Asian opponents. The spinner has accounted for 29 wickets to this point against Bangladesh in Tests and is barely three wickets far off from surpassing Zaheer Khan’s tally of 31 wickets to alter into one of many crucial best wicket-taker for India against the opponent.
  • Ravichandran Ashwin is barely 26 runs far off from eclipsing Murali Vijay’s 295 runs and 76 runs shy of going past Ajinkya Rahane’s 345 runs against Bangladesh in Tests.
